Job Title: VP of Marketing
Job Summary:
The Vice President of Marketing is a strategic leader responsible for developing and executing SimiTree's marketing strategy to drive brand awareness, customer acquisition, and revenue growth. This role oversees all marketing functions, including brand management, digital marketing, product marketing, communications, and market research. The VP of Marketing works closely with executive leadership to align marketing initiatives with business goals and ensure a consistent and compelling brand presence across all channels.

About the company
SimiTree Healthcare Consulting unites former Simione and BlackTree experts, services, and approaches to help post-acute organizations raise performance levels and realize revenue potential in a complex market. SimiTree's services include Consulting, Mergers & Acquistions, Talent Solutions, Data Analytics, and Outsourced Services for home health, hospice, and palliative industries.
